Remote Power for Remote Wireless

This is ideal for remote sites with no AC power. This can include a Wireless WAN site for remote CCTV monitoring or a wireless internet project.Implementing a solar-powered site with a battery bank that will power equipment, consider the following:

Depending on the solar site, load requirements will vary. Higher load capacity will allow for increased usage duty cycle, increased radio throughput/transmit power to accommodate devices added on the network, increased support for more no-sun days, and account for environmental conditions that lead to increased use of heater/blower.
